The Echo of the cat
This captivating pen drawing features a mysterious cat with large, expressive eyes that seem to hold untold secrets. The intricate lines and deep shadows create a rich texture, giving the artwork a sense of depth and realism. Blurred ink splatters add an ethereal quality, enhancing the enigmatic aura of the piece. The seamless blend of realistic detail and abstract elements draws viewers into a world of intrigue, symbolizing the fragile balance of nature.
This artwork poignantly reflects the current state of our planet, highlighting the profound changes in the climate and environment caused by human activity. The cat’s piercing gaze serves as a silent plea, urging us to take immediate action to protect and preserve our world. If we fail to act now, the artwork warns, it might soon be too late to reverse the damage.
